A Communication Model Proposal Based on Transmedia Narrative and Spreadable media
Journal Title: RHS-Revista Humanismo y Sociedad - Year 2023, Vol 11, Issue 1
Abstract
This article presents a proposal for a communication model based on transmedia narrative and spreadable media, both concepts developed by the American academic Henry Jenkins (2008 and 2013). This proposal was intended to facilitate the dissemination of content associated with a strategy to promote family coexistence in the Colombian city of Medellín and its metropolitan area. The process was designed in phases, in which methods of Internet audience studies and content analysis were combined. The article is divided into five parts: first, the model is introduced, defined and justified; second, its use is delimited; third, its elements are described; fourth, its structure is presented; finally, the text closes presenting a series of conclusions and the limitations of this proposal. The conclusions show alternative dynamics of production, narration, consumption and dissemination of stories to facilitate other processes that are in tune with the purposes of communication for social change, in particular, the generation of involvement and commitment of users. The model is not intended to be replicable, but to represent a specific moment, circumstances and situations.
